Career path
| Career Role (Fisheries Data Sharing) | Description |
|---|---|
| Data Analyst - Fisheries | Analyze large datasets, identify trends, and create reports on UK fisheries data. Essential for sustainable management. |
| Fisheries Data Scientist | Develop advanced models and algorithms for predicting fish stocks and optimizing fishing practices. High demand role. |
| Marine Data Specialist | Manage and curate marine data, ensuring quality and accessibility for researchers and stakeholders. Crucial for policy decisions. |
| GIS Specialist - Fisheries | Utilize geographic information systems to map and visualize fisheries data, supporting spatial analysis and resource management. |
| Fisheries Biostatistician | Apply statistical methods to analyze biological data related to fisheries, informing stock assessment and conservation efforts. |
